    Notes 
    • (Medical):The mesentery is an organ that attaches the intestines to the posterior abdominal wall in humans and is formed by the double fold of peritoneum. It helps in storing fat and allowing blood vessels, lymphatics, and nerves to supply the intestines, among other functions. The mesenteric arteries take blood from the aorta and distribute it to a large portion of the gastrointestinal tract. Mesenteric disease is where the blood supply is blocked to the intestines.
